*GOD HAS A PURPOSE FOR YOUR LIFE* (Evang. Emeka Chieki)
As l looked up in a dictionary the word " purpose" l discovered that, it is the reason for which something is done or created or for which something exists. So, God has a purpose for your life to fulfill in this world and not for you to run on your own Accord and strength pursing what is not your purpose. Lack of understanding of your purpose in this life will bring chaos and misery.
Let us look at the life of Prophet Jeremiah and his purpose which God revealed to him. ( Jeremiah 1:5) " Before l formed thee in the belly l knew thee ; and before thou camest forth out of the womb l sanctified thee, and l ordained thee a Prophet unto the nations. By this word of the Lord to Jeremiah, it reveals to us the omniscient, omnipotent nature of God. He designed a role for Jeremiah to play in the life of the children of Israel His chosen nation. When He chooses you for purpose, He backs you up with His power and might, because of the opposition you will encounter in this word. See what He told Jeremiah in ( Jeremiah 1: 7, 8,10, 17-19) " But the Lord said unto me, say not , l am a child; for thou shall go to all that l shall send thee, and whatsoever l command thee thou shall speak (8) Be not afraid of their faces : for l am with thee to deliver thee , saith the Lord. (10) See, l have this day set thee over the nations and over the Kingdoms , to root out, and to pull down, and to destroy, and to throw down, to build, and to plant (17) Thou therefore gird up thy loins and arise, and speak unto them all that l command thee: be not dismayed at their faces, lest l confound thee before them. (18) For, behold, l have made thee this day a defensed city, and an iron pillar, and brasen walls against the whole land, against the Kings of Judah, against the princes thereof, against the priests thereof, and against the people of the land.(19) And they shall fight against thee; but they shall not prevail against thee; for l am with thee, saith the Lord, to deliver thee." This is what He told Jeremiah and telling you today of His iron clad promise to fulfill His purpose for your life.
In the book of 2 Timothy 1:9 " Who hath saved us, and called us with an holy calling, not according to our works, but according to his own purpose and grace, which was given us in Christ Jesus before the world began". What Christ did for us on the Cross of Calvary, we did not call Him, rather He called us into His marvelous light and purpose.He opened the way to God through what He did for us on the Cross, We need now to place our faith in Him and what He did for us on the Cross of Calvary and ask Him to reveal His purpose for our lives. Not for us to grope in the dark and do all sort of things, thinking we are serving God. He preserve's and protect His purpose in any man He called . ( Romans 8:31) " What shall we then say to these things? If God be for us, who can be against us"? (This refers to the suffering presently endured,in comparison to " Glory which shall be revealed in us, believers". Since God is for us,it is who can be against us that will really matter)
